The combat system in Final Fantasy X is a refined turn-based Active Time Battle (ATB) system, emphasizing strategic planning and character synergy. Understanding the nuances of this system is key to overcoming the game's formidable challenges.
The ATB System Explained
In FFX's ATB system, characters act based on their Speed stat and the order of actions displayed on the Conditional Turn-Based (CTB) screen. Enemies also have their turn order displayed, allowing you to anticipate their moves and plan your own accordingly. This system rewards strategic thinking over pure reaction time.
Character Roles and Abilities
Each party member fills a distinct role:
- Tidus: A physical attacker with high Speed and Strength, excelling in single-target damage.
- Yuna: A white mage and summoner, focused on healing, support, and powerful Aeon summons.
- Wakka: A versatile character who can inflict status ailments and deal damage with his sature Blitzball attacks.
- Lulu: A black mage specializing in powerful elemental magic.
- Kimahri: A flexible character who can be trained as a physical attacker or a support unit.
- Auron: A strong physical attacker and tank, capable of dealing heavy damage and withstanding powerful blows.
- Rikku: A swift thief who excels at stealing items and using the Mix ability to combine items for unique effects.
Abilities and Magic
Characters learn new abilities and magic spells by progressing along the Sphere Grid. These range from offensive spells like Fire and Thunder to defensive buffs like Protect and Shell, and status-inflicting abilities like Sleep and Poison.
Overdrives and Limit Breaks
When a character's Overdrive gauge is full, they can unleash a powerful special attack. These are learned through various means, often by performing specific actions in battle or by using certain items. Mastering Overdrives is essential for dealing with the game's toughest bosses.
Summoning Aeons
Yuna's ability to summon Aeons is a critical combat mechanic. Aeons are powerful allies that can be called into battle to fight independently or to unleash their own devastating Overdrives. Each Aeon has unique strengths and weaknesses.
Strategic Combat Tips
- Exploit Weaknesses: Use elemental magic and abilities to exploit enemy weaknesses.
- Status Effects: Utilize status ailments like Poison, Sleep, and Slow to control the battlefield.
- Buffs and Debuffs: Apply beneficial status effects to your party (e.g., Protect, Haste) and detrimental ones to enemies (e.g., Slow, Defense Down).
- Overdrive Management: Save Overdrives for critical moments or to finish off powerful enemies.
- Party Synergy: Combine the abilities of your party members for maximum effectiveness.
